FOCIL: The Wingwoman of Transaction Inclusion

FOCIL’s basically the wingwoman you never knew you needed. Instead of relying on one block proposer (who’s probably flakey anyway), it’s got up to 17 random includers per slot. So even if the block builders are having a bad day, your transactions are still getting that VIP treatment.

Vitalik’s all, “Even if the block production turns into a drama fest, FOCIL’s got your back. Transactions? Included in one to two slots. Mic drop.”

EIP-8141: Smart Accounts Without the Drama

EIP-8141’s here to make smart accounts the popular kids on the blockchain. Multisigs, quantum-resistant signatures, gas-sponsored transactions-they’re all getting the red carpet treatment. No more wrappers or relayers. It’s like transactions finally got their own Netflix special.

Vitalik’s like, “Privacy protocols? Yeah, they’re coming to the party too. Paymasters, multi-tenant accounts-Ethereum’s got room for everyone.”

Ethereum Drama: Leadership Shifts and Price Dips

Oh, and in case you missed it, the Ethereum Foundation had a little leadership shuffle. Tomasz Stańczak stepped down, and Bastian Aue’s now co-running the show. Meanwhile, Vitalik’s out here saying Ethereum doesn’t need more EVM-compatible chains. “Scale within, people!” he’s yelling from the rooftops.

But let’s not forget the elephant in the room: ETH’s price. At the time of writing, it’s chilling at $1,926, down 2.4% in the last 24 hours. Trading volume? $19 billion. Market cap? Still above $232 billion. But hey, who’s counting?
